Robert Hills: A Pioneer of British Animal Studies

Robert Hills (1769 – 1844) stands as a significant figure in the annals of British Romantic art, particularly renowned for his meticulous and expressive animal studies—a genre that predates its widespread acceptance and cemented his reputation as a master of realism. Born in London, Hills’ artistic journey began amidst the burgeoning fascination with scientific observation and natural history during the Enlightenment era, shaping profoundly his approach to portraying the natural world.
  • Early Life & Education: Hills received a formal education at Eton College, fostering an appreciation for classical art alongside developing technical skills crucial for capturing nuanced detail.
  • Influence of Anatomy and Zoology: His formative years coincided with advancements in anatomical illustration and zoological research—influences that instilled within him a dedication to accurate representation and a profound understanding of animal musculature and skeletal structure. This meticulous attention to detail would become a hallmark of his artistic style.
Hills’ artistic career blossomed during the Regency period, establishing himself as a prolific painter and illustrator. He gained considerable acclaim for his depictions of livestock—sheep, rams, cattle—executed with remarkable precision and imbued with palpable emotion. Unlike many artists of his time who favored idealized landscapes or mythological subjects, Hills focused squarely on capturing the essence of rural life and animal behavior. His canvases aren’t merely representations; they are windows into a bygone era, conveying not only visual accuracy but also psychological depth.
  • Technique & Style: Hills employed a technique characterized by smooth brushstrokes and subtle tonal gradations—a hallmark of British Academic painting—allowing him to achieve astonishing realism. He meticulously studied animal anatomy, painstakingly sketching muscle groups and skeletal structures before applying paint with painstaking care.
